Art and culture
Births
- 1684 - Antoine Watteau, French painter (d. 1721)
- 1901 - Alberto Giacometti, Swiss sculptor (d. 1966)
- 1924 - Ed Wood, American filmmaker (d. 1978)
- 1930 - Harold Pinter, English playwright
Deaths
- 1837 - Charles Fourier, French philosopher (b. 1772)
- 1985 - Orson Welles, American director and actor (b. 1915)
